Headline differences: Both share Action, Indie on Steam. Crushed (2020) is 5 years older than Byte of the Dead (2025). Byte of the Dead is currently ~80% cheaper on Steam than Crushed (1.99 USD vs. 9.99 USD). Does Byte of the Dead have multiplayer like Crushed?
No. Crushed supports multiplayer on Steam (Multi-player, Online Co-op, Co-op), while Byte of the Dead is listed as single-player only.
Does Crushed run on Steam Deck?
Yes — Crushed is rated Deck Playable by Valve. Byte of the Dead doesn't have a Deck rating yet, so its Deck behaviour is currently unverified.
